I have only a tiny experience to share and it is different than Alex's plumbing. The Pressure Relief Valve for the Caretaker in-floor system is installed BEFORE the 5-port Caretaker valve. So if pressure builds up trying to get through any port of the Caretaker valve, the back-pressure can be released through the Pressure Relief Valve, which is plumbed back to the pool wall returns, bypassing the 2-way valve that selected the Caretaker line. I assume there is some kind of pressure threshold (30 lbs?) the Relief valve has to reach before water actually goes through it.
